Animal Crossing Is Getting Sanrio-Inspired Villagers And Items Next Month

Following the game’s 1.9.0 update, you’ll be able to use the Sanrio Amiibo cards to invite new villagers and unlock special Sanrio items.

Sanrio-motivated locals, furniture, and different things are coming to Animal Crossing: New Horizons in the game’s March update. Following the update, you’ll have the option to welcome new townspeople and request things themed after Hello Kitty, My Melody, Cinnamoroll, and other Sanrio characters by examining the Animal Crossing Sanrio Amiibo cards.

Similarly, as in Animal Crossing: New Leaf, there are six Sanrio-inspired townspeople altogether, one for every one of the cards in the Sanrio Amiibo pack. The full rundown of locals and the Sanrio character they’re themed after is as per the following:

  • Kerokerokeroppi – Toby (rabbit)
  • Cinnamoroll – Chai (elephant)
  • Pompompurin – Marty (cub)
  • My Melody – Chelsea (deer)
  • Kiki & Lala – Étoile (sheep)
  • Hello Kitty – Rilla (gorilla)

You’ll additionally have the option to arrange different furnishings and dress things dependent on the Sanrio characters, for example, a Cinnamoroll lounge chair and a Hello Kitty mat. These things and locals will all be acquainted with the game in the 1.9.0 update, which is scheduled to deliver on March 18. The Sanrio Amiibo cards themselves were first delivered in Japan and Europe back in 2016 to coincide with Animal Crossing: New Leaf’s large Welcome Amiibo update, yet they’ll be accessible without precedent for the US beginning March 26.

The card packs will be sold only at Target stores, and each pack contains all six Sanrio Amiibo cards. Meanwhile, Nintendo as of late released New Horizons’ Mario update, which presented a line of Super Mario furniture and items to the game, for example, twist pipes. The Mario things will all be accessible to arrange from Nook Shopping beginning March 1.

The update likewise added a modest bunch of new occasional items, which will go on sale at various focuses all through March.
